  1. About Kean University. Located in Union and Hillside, New Jersey, Kean University is the third largest public university in New Jersey as well as being the state’s largest producer of teachers. The university was founded as the Newark Normal School in 1855 by Stephen Congar, the Newark Superintendent of Schools, and over the years it began to ...

  4. Founded in 1855, Kean University was the first public post-secondary institution in New Jersey. With a rich history of excellence and innovation in higher education, Kean is a world-class, vibrant and diverse university offering more than 50 undergraduate majors and more than 60 options for graduate study, including six doctoral programs in a ...

  5. The Michael Graves College at Kean University carries the name and endorsement of a man who was one of the world’s premiere architects and designers—Michael Graves. Graves is credited with broadening the role of the architect and designer in society and raising public interest in good design as essential to the quality of everyday life.

  7. Kean University is a medium-sized public university located on a suburban campus in Union, New Jersey. It has a total undergraduate enrollment of 10,573, and admissions are selective, with an acceptance rate of 79%. The university offers 55 bachelor's degrees, has an average graduation rate of 48%, and a student-faculty ratio of 16:1.
